The secret of load detection in washing machines

Almost all modern washing machines in the top end and medium price ranges have an automatic load detection feature. Using this function, the washing machine is able to react and adapt to the fill volume by optimally adjusting its water consumption depending on the load status and to suggest the amount of detergent that is required. The reduced consumption of an optimised washing machine quickly convinces end consumers of these additional benefits. To enable load detection, the latest sensor equipment is required. Micro-Epsilon from Ortenburg provides new possibilities for measuring the load.

Two new thermoIMAGER TIM 160 and 160/DK

Micro-Epsilon has extended its range of thermoIMAGER TIM infrared cameras. Due to further research and development of the TIM system using new components and a modified FPA detector, the cost of the camera has been reduced significantly.
